python定位话题讨论。解读python定位知识,想了解学习python定位,请参与python定位话题讨论。
python定位话题已于 2025-08-07 08:34:30 更新
定位依据:loc:主要基于行和列的标签进行定位。这些标签可以是描述性的字符串,比如’row1’、’columnA’。iloc:主要基于行和列的位置进行定位,使用数字索引。查询范围:loc:查询范围是包含指定标签的。例如,.loc[0, 'a']会选取包含标签’0’的行和列’a...
1. 使用CSS选择器的部分匹配功能 如果ID或类名的一部分是静态的,你可以利用CSS选择器的“包含”(*=)、“开始于”(^=)或“结束于”($=)特性来进行元素定位。包含某文本的属性值:driver.find_element_by_css_selector("ul[id*='部分ID']")以某文本开头的属性值:driver.find_element_by_...
1. **id定位**:使用`find_element_by_id()`方法。通过元素的唯一id属性进行定位。例如,在百度搜索框中,通过`find_element_by_id('kw')`定位搜索框,并输入文本“selenium”。2. **name定位**:使用`find_element_by_name()`方法。通过元素的name属性进行定位。同样以百度搜索框为例,通过`...
Python是一种跨平台的计算机程序设计语言。具体来说:起源与定位:Python是ABC语言的替代品,提供高效的高级数据结构,支持简单有效的面向对象编程。它是一种面向对象的动态类型语言,最初被设计用于编写自动化脚本。发展与应用:随着版本的不断更新和语言新功能的添加,Python越来越多地被用于独立的、大型项...
1、文件被损坏或者安装不正确造成的: 直接的GUI就打不开,或者打开闪退; 建议重新修复一下,或者卸掉重新安装。 设置的不正确,或者误操作: 设置的问题:将Python的安装路径加入到环境变量中; 误操作:就是代码中包含错误,一般是缩进问题,程序不执行,请检查代码。Python除了极少的事情不能做之外,...
发行方与定位:Python:是开源的编程语言,由Python Software Foundation维护,是全球广泛使用的通用编程语言。ActivePython:是由ActiveState公司推出的专用Python编程和调试工具,它包含了完整的Python内核,并附加了一些特定功能。附加功能与工具:Python:提供基础的编程环境和标准库,用户可以根据需要安装第三方...
Python是一种通用的、解释型的计算机程序设计语言,它的语法简洁清晰,具有丰富和强大的库和框架,可以用于各种应用开发。Python的设计哲学强调代码的可读性和简洁性,使得它成为多数初学者入门的第一种编程语言。Python的定位 Python被归类为高级编程语言,这意味着它隐藏了底层计算机操作的复杂性,让开发者...
1. 页面元素定位方式不同:在Python中定位元素的方法有很多种,常见的有xpath、css_selector、id、name等。如果在Python中能够定位到元素B,但是在Dbug中无法定位到,那么可能是Dbug中的定位方式和Python中的不同。2. 页面加载速度不同:有时候我们会遇到这样的情况,即在Python中能够成功定位到元素,...
Python的定位:Python是一种高级编程语言,主要用于开发应用软件。它可以用来开发各种类型的应用,如网站、Web应用、桌面应用、移动应用、数据分析工具、人工智能应用等。Python具有丰富的库和框架,使得它在各个领域都有广泛的应用。因此,Python不属于系统软件,而是作为开发应用软件的重要工具之一,属于应用...
定位某个字符串,可以使用字符串函数find(sub[,start[,end]]),返回匹配sub字符串的第一个对象的起始索引位置,或使用re模块下的re.search(pattern, string)方法,查找第一个匹配的位置,并返回一个匹配对象(match object,里面包含匹配的起始和终止位置信息等)。至于截取的操作,我其实不是很明白,...